Aimee Concepcion Chavez | 2023 | ISBN: 177469395X | English | 240 pages | True PDF | 11 MB

This book takes the readers through several aspects of teaching students with learning disabilities. This book sheds light on the several characteristics of teachers who give their time to teaching students with various learning disabilities. The first chapter stresses the basic overview of teaching students with learning disabilities so that the readers are clear about the philosophies behind that form the utmost basics in the field. This chapter will also emphasize signs, principles, and various teaching methods for the teachers who teach students with LD. The second chapter takes the readers through the various strategies that play a major role in teaching students with LD. This chapter will provide highlights on the various key topics such as definition and benefits of various learning strategies, models of learning strategies instruction, and effective teaching strategies for students with LD. Then, the third chapter explains the concepts of learning disabilities - neurological bases, clinical features, and strategies of intervention. It also explains the epistemological ambiguities of the field, neural correlates in learning disabilities, and identifying and remediating dyslexia in kindergarten and the foundation year. The fourth chapter introduces the readers to the philosophy behind the language teaching. This chapter also explains the importance of phases of teaching, qualities of a good language teacher, and history of language teaching. The fifth chapter throws light on how to engage learners with complex learning disabilities. This chapter contains learning disabilities and mathematics, students' difficulties related to comprehension of text, and application of assistive technology adaptations to include students with learning disabilities in cooperative learning activities. The sixth chapter takes the readers through the concept of second language acquisition - pedagogies, practices, and perspectives. The readers are then told about teaching the prosody of emotive communication in a second language, foundations of second language acquisition, and the linguistics of second language acquisition. In the last chapter of this book, sheds light on the challenges and opportunities in teaching students with learning disabilities. This chapter also mentions the challenges and opportunities for students with learning disabilities in social studies and history, instructional and structural challenges, and what a teacher can do for students with learning disabilities.

This book has been designed to suit the knowledge and pursuit of the researcher and scholars and to empower them with various aspects of teaching students with learning disabilities (LD), so that they are updated with the information.
